Understanding Resource Networks

A resource network transcends basic contact lists or organizational directories by serving as a vibrant ecosystem of capabilities and relationships. At its core, a resource network integrates multiple domains, including human capital, technological platforms, informational assets, and physical infrastructure. When harmonized under a unified strategy, these diverse elements empower teams to mobilize knowledge and tools rapidly, ensuring that critical initiatives never stall due to gaps in expertise or capacity.

Human capital in a resource network typically comprises external consultants, alumni associations, independent contractors, and specialized communities of practice. By tapping into these talent pools, a business can scale expertise on demand without the overhead of permanent hires. Technological assets such as cloud services, SaaS integrations, open APIs, and collaboration software knit these contributors together, enabling seamless data exchange and workflow automation.

Informational resources—ranging from proprietary datasets and research papers to training modules and best-practice repositories—fuel innovation by democratizing access to knowledge. Many organizations maintain in-house libraries or subscribe to academic and governmental portals, for example through collaborations with institutions like National Science Foundation. Meanwhile, physical infrastructure components such as co-working spaces, regional labs, and event venues provide critical touchpoints for face-to-face collaboration and prototyping.

Central governance plays a pivotal role in ensuring consistency, risk management, and compliance. By establishing clear policies, communication protocols, and decision-making hierarchies, organizations can avoid duplication of effort and maintain high standards across all network activities. Advanced analytics dashboards further enhance visibility, enabling executives to track resource allocations and performance trends in real time, and adapt quickly to changing priorities.

The evolution of resource networks now includes emerging concepts such as digital twins, which create virtual representations of supply chains or facility layouts. These digital replicas allow teams to run simulations, forecast demand fluctuations, and identify optimal configurations before committing physical or financial resources. Incorporating such innovations into the resource network roadmap can drive even greater efficiencies and risk mitigation.

The Strategic Advantages of a Resource Network

Organizations that leverage a well-tuned resource network gain multiple competitive levers. First, scalability is vastly improved: rather than investing in permanent infrastructure or full-time staff, businesses can draw on external partners and pay-as-you-go platforms. This flexibility reduces upfront capital commitments and allows enterprises to expand capabilities in sync with demand.

Agility, too, receives a significant boost. When a new product line or market opportunity emerges, prequalified collaborators and modular services enable rapid time-to-market. Cross-functional teams can integrate expert consultants or specialized agencies at critical junctures, avoiding the typical bottlenecks associated with meritocratic hiring cycles or procurement processes.

Innovation gains momentum through exposure to diverse perspectives and specialized know-how. A robust network encourages cross-pollination of ideas by bringing together stakeholders from different industries, research institutions, and geographic regions. Government and university studies consistently underscore the correlation between open innovation ecosystems and breakthrough performance.

Risk mitigation emerges as another key benefit. Distributing critical functions—such as data analysis, manufacturing, or customer support—across multiple suppliers and technologies reduces single points of failure. Combined with quality governance and compliance checks, this approach bolsters operational resilience in the face of supply chain disruptions or regulatory changes.

Finally, cost efficiency becomes a natural outcome. Shared asset models, group purchasing agreements, and usage-based billing structures drive significant savings. Businesses can also negotiate volume discounts and leverage partner networks for bulk procurement or research subscriptions, translating into leaner budgets and stronger profit margins.

To quantify the impact of these advantages, many firms track return on investment through metrics like cost avoidance, incremental revenue, and cycle time improvements. Building a Resource Network: A Step-by-Step Blueprint

Define Strategic Goals

Success starts with clarity of purpose. Leadership teams must articulate specific objectives for their resource network. Whether the aim is to accelerate R&D, penetrate new territories, or optimize supply chain logistics, these goals will dictate which assets and partnerships are most critical. By aligning network ambitions with overall corporate strategy, companies ensure each collaboration contributes measurable value.

Inventory Current Resources

Next, conduct a thorough internal audit. Document existing capabilities, including staff expertise, technology licenses, proprietary data stores, and physical facilities. Identify strengths as well as deficits where outside support is required. Visualization tools—such as capability heat maps or flow diagrams—can clarify overlaps and reveal strategic gaps that warrant external supplementation.

Vet and Select Partners

Partner selection is a pivotal step. Tap into professional networks, industry forums, and referral platforms to identify candidates whose track records and cultural values align with your own. Evaluate potential collaborators on criteria such as scalability of their offerings, data security certifications, domain expertise, and client satisfaction ratings. A disciplined vetting process reduces the risk of misaligned expectations later on.

Formalize Governance Frameworks

Effective resource networks require clear rules of engagement. Define roles, communication channels, performance metrics, and escalation protocols. Draft agreements such as service-level arrangements, non-disclosure contracts, and data-sharing policies to protect intellectual property and ensure accountability. Periodically review and update these documents to reflect evolving needs and regulatory requirements.

Implement, Monitor, and Iterate

After launching initial partnerships and workflows, maintain an iterative improvement cycle. Collect performance data, gather stakeholder feedback, and refine processes on a regular cadence. Use agile principles to prioritize enhancements based on impact and effort, ensuring the network evolves alongside shifting business imperatives and technological advancements.

Best Practices for Managing Your Resource Network

Operational excellence in resource networking hinges on consistent, transparent management practices. Establish a centralized knowledge hub—such as a secure intranet or cloud-based portal—where stakeholders access documented processes, dashboards, and collaboration tools. This eliminates silos and accelerates onboarding of new participants.

Regular touchpoints keep relationships vibrant and issues on the table. Schedule quarterly reviews to assess performance metrics like utilization rates and cycle times. Complement these with informal virtual meetups—“coffee chats” or lunch-and-learn sessions—that foster trust and spark fresh ideas.

Performance tracking should rely on quantifiable indicators. Key performance metrics might include lead times for resource allocation, partner satisfaction scores, cost savings versus traditional models, and innovation throughput. Periodic surveys and open forums—leveraging guidance from the U.S. Small Business Administration on stakeholder engagement—can surface improvement opportunities and validate strategic priorities.

Implement feedback loops to capture real-time insights. Anonymous suggestion boxes or integrated feedback features in collaboration platforms help uncover blind spots and encourage continuous adaptation. Celebrating successes and sharing lessons learned further cements a culture of collective ownership.

Finally, streamline partner onboarding with standardized playbooks, digital checklists, and modular training modules. This scalable approach accelerates time-to-value and ensures each collaborator understands governance expectations from day one.

Maintaining robust security and compliance within a resource network is critical. Enforce least-privilege access controls, conduct regular third-party audits, and align with industry standards such as ISO 27001 or SOC 2. A proactive approach to data governance not only protects sensitive information but also builds trust with partners and end users.

Real-World Case Study: Scaling Through a Resource Network

Consider a mid-sized software company that needed to expand support coverage across multiple continents. The internal team lacked bandwidth and domain expertise in several regions, leading to delayed response times and customer dissatisfaction. By architecting a global resource network, they tapped into vetted freelance engineers, regional support agencies, and AI-driven ticket triage tools.

This hybrid model delivered a 50% reduction in average response times and cut support costs by 30%. Customer satisfaction scores rose by over 20%, laying the groundwork for higher renewal rates and positive referrals. Central to this success was a digital partner portal that automated ticket routing, provided real-time performance dashboards, and enforced service-level agreements.

Leadership held monthly review sessions to analyze key metrics, adjust partner allocations, and refine escalation workflows. Joint training workshops and virtual hackathons strengthened interpersonal bonds and surfaced novel automation projects. Over the course of a few quarters, the resource network evolved into a self-optimizing system that prioritized high-impact tasks and scaled seamlessly as user volumes grew.

Lessons from this case include the importance of rigorous partner vetting, investments in integrated collaboration platforms, and the use of data to drive continuous performance improvements. The organization emerged more resilient, able to reconfigure its support network in response to region-specific demands and technological advances without major capital expenditures.

FAQ

What is a resource network?

A resource network is a dynamic ecosystem of internal and external assets, including human expertise, technological tools, informational repositories, and physical infrastructure, designed to deliver capabilities on demand.

How does a digital twin enhance a resource network?

Digital twins allow teams to create virtual replicas of physical systems—such as supply chains or facility layouts—enabling simulation, forecasting, and optimization before deploying real-world changes.

What governance structures are essential for effective resource networks?

Key governance structures include clear roles and responsibilities, communication protocols, service-level agreements, data-sharing policies, and performance metrics to ensure accountability and alignment.
